RECENT changes to the Fenland bus timetable will, almost certainly, have made little difference to most people since the reason some Sunday services were cancelled was because no one was using them anyway.

But spare a thought, if you would, for one chap who does have to use a bus service through the Fens on a Sunday and is now finding it a nightmare to committee.

The commuter in questions lives in Wimblington but works in Wisbech- a simple enough proposition one might imagine. However to get to and from Wimblington on a Sunday it means he has to firstly catch a bus to Peterborough and then hop on another bus from Peterborough to get to work in Wisbech.

Anyone visiting friends or relatives in North Cambs Hospital in Wisbech will, I assume, be faced with a similar journey.
